The People's Party of Andalusia (Spanish: Partido Popular de Andalucía, PP), informally also known as the Andalusian People's Party (Spanish: Partido Popular Andaluz, PPA), is the regional wing of the Spanish People's Party operating in Andalusia. It will be the largest political party in the Parliament of Andalusia, and have an outright majority following the elections in 2022.
Party leaders
- Gabino Puche, 1989–1993
- Javier Arenas, 1993–1999
- Teófila Martínez, 1999–2004
- Javier Arenas, 2004–2012
- Juan Ignacio Zoido, 2012–2014
- Juan Manuel Moreno Bonilla, 2014–present
Electoral performance
Parliament of Andalusia
Parliament of Andalusia | |||||||
Election | Leading candidate | Votes | % | Seats | +/– | Government | |
---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|
1990 | Gabino Puche | 611,903 | 22.18 (#2) | 26 / 109 | 2[a] | Opposition | |
1994 | Javier Arenas | 1,238,252 | 34.36 (#2) | 41 / 109 | 15 | Opposition | |
1996 | 1,466,980 | 33.96 (#2) | 40 / 109 | 1 | Opposition | ||
2000 | Teófila Martínez | 1,535,987 | 38.02 (#2) | 46 / 109 | 6 | Opposition | |
2004 | 1,426,774 | 31.78 (#2) | 37 / 109 | 9 | Opposition | ||
2008 | Javier Arenas | 1,730,154 | 38.45 (#2) | 47 / 109 | 10 | Opposition | |
2012 | 1,570,833 | 40.67 (#1) | 50 / 109 | 3 | Opposition | ||
2015 | Juan Manuel Moreno | 1,065,685 | 26.74 (#2) | 33 / 109 | 17 | Opposition | |
2018 | 750,778 | 20.75 (#2) | 26 / 109 | 7 | Coalition | ||
2022 | 1,582,412 | 43.13 (#1) | 58 / 109 | 32 | Majority |
